WebAug 26, 2024 · Overflow rate is an empirical parameter describing the settling characteristics of solids in a specific wastewater. Overflow rate is defined as the volume of water flow per unit of time divided by the surface area of the settling basin. We can multiply recursively to overcome the difficulty of overflow. To multiply a*b, first calculate a*b/2 then add it twice. For calculating a*b/2 calculate a*b/4 and so on (similar to log n exponentiation algorithm ). // To compute (a * b) % mod multiply (a, b, mod) 1) ll res = 0; // Initialize result 2) a = a % mod.

WebBinary Overflow. One caveat with signed binary numbers is that of overflow, where the answer to an addition or subtraction problem exceeds the magnitude which can be represented with the allotted number of bits. WebThe transistors that implement the overflow circuit in the 6502 microprocessor. The circuits on the left compute the NAND and NOR of the top bits of A and B. The circuit on the right computes the overflow flag. Based on the remarkable transistor-level schematic of the full 6502 chip, reverse-engineered by Balazs.

WebQueue is a linear data structure where the first element is inserted from one end called REAR and deleted from the other end called as FRONT. Front points to the beginning of the queue and Rear points to the end of the queue. Queue follows the FIFO (First - In - First Out) structure.
